Technical Specifications
MODEL
QUO MORPH
FEATURES
Bluetooth speaker
Call Handsfree
Phone, Tablet or Computer stand
Volume/Song track control
COMPATIBILITY
Bluetooth 3.0
TRANSMISSION DISTANCE
10 Meters
FRECUENCY RANGE
180Hz-20KHz
SPEAKER UNIT
Diameter 40mm, inner magnetic 4Ω,3W*2
AUDIO INPUT CONECTOR
3.5mm
AUX CABLE
support aux external audio input.
CHARGING INTERFACE
Micro USB
BATTERY
Built-in lithium battery, 3.7V/1000mAh
CHARGING VOLTAGE
5V/1A
CHARGING TIME
3-4 hours
WORKING TIME
6 hours
MATERIAL
ABS + Rubber
SENSITIVITY
≥90dB
DISTORTION
≤ 1%
WEIGHT
348g
SIZE
135*72*49 mm
CONTENT & ACCESSORIES
User manual, 1x USB charging cable, 1x 3.5mm
AUX cable
WARRANTY
1 Year

This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ital device,
pursuant to part 15 of F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ection
against harmful interference in a residential installation. This equipment generates and can radiate
rad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instructions, may
cause har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is no guarantee that
inter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does cause harmful
inter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ment
off and on, the user is encouraged to try to correct theinterference by one or more of the
following measures:
--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
--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ver.
--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ver is connected.
--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for help.
This device complies with Part 15 of F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following two
conditions: (1)This device may not cause harmful interference, and (2)This device must accept
any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ation.
